QATAR BEGINS SUPPLYING NATURAL GAS TO SYRIA THROUGH JORDAN
Qatar has begun providing natural gas to Syria through Jordan to tackle the country’s electricity shortage and power cuts, state news agency QNA has reported. In a statement issued on Thursday, Qatar said the initiative comes as part of a deal signed with Jordan and in collaboration with the United Nations Development Programme. According to the agreement, Qatar will provide natural gas supplies “generating power from 400 megawatts of electricity daily and gradually increase production at the Deir Ali power plant in Syria”. The electricity will be distributed to several Syrian cities, including the capital Damascus, Rif Dimashq, As Suwayda, Daraa, Al Qunaitra, Homs, Hama, Tartous, Latakia, Aleppo, and Deir ez-Zur, it added.
